Devolution of open spaces to Town and Parish Councils

28/03/2019 - Devolution of open spaces to Town and Parish Councils

(Key decision):

 

(1) To agree to enter into a lease/management arrangement for Riverside Country Park with Newhaven Town Council on terms to be agreed and to be reported to Cabinet before completion of that lease/management agreement.

 

(2) To agree to amend the existing boundary line at Lewes Road Recreation Ground, Newhaven to reflect the boundary of the previous landfill site to enable devolution of the Lewes Road Recreation Ground to Newhaven Town Council

 

(3) To agree to vary the standard form of overage provision to allow a specific development, commensurate with the use of the site, to take place at Lewes Road Recreation Ground, Newhaven.

 

(4) To agree in principle the devolution to Lewes Town Council of Mountfield Road Pleasure Ground and and Stanley Turner Recreation Ground, subject to:

 

(i) exploring with the Charity Commission the substitution of Lewes Town Council as sole charitable trustee in place of Lewes District Council

 

(ii) consideration of the future management arrangements of the car park at Mountfield Road.

 

(iii) officers reporting back to Cabinet for final agreement on final terms of devolution.

 

(5) To agree to devolve the Hollycroft Field site, including play space to East Chiltington Parish Council on the basis that the whole of the site including grass verges will be transferred, subject to due diligence and associated matters on the part of the Parish Council and agreement on the future maintenance of the site.
